Transaction 6e3a7a4caad86c7b2ad581ef540df7cc761607f74bf669210dc088cadc2a7e93
1 Input
1 Output
-
6e3a7a4caad86c7b2ad581ef540df7cc761607f74bf669210dc088cadc2a7e93:0
- value
- 678363
- script pubkey
- OP_0 OP_PUSHBYTES_20 52ba1bef377187dcca64057164dd311c9491b26b
- address
- bc1q22aphmehwxraejnyq4ckfhf3rj2frvnttlx6lf